内容記述 | A transonic wind tunnel test of an HLFC (Hybrid Laminar Flow Control) wing model with a new leading edge suction system incorporated with a natural laminar flow airfoil was conducted to check mainly the drag reducing effect of the suction system in the transonic Mach number range. The test confirmed that the system works well in both design and off-design conditions, resulting in significant drag reduction in a wake drag with even a small amount of suction. Besides the drag reducing effect, it was found that the system produces considerable lift increase for some suction quantity ranges in a wide range of test Mach number. The lift increment generates a higher L/D (overall wing Lift/overall wing Drag) value than that which may be expected from the drag reduction alone. | |||||
